This paper presents the algorithms of digital control system of impulseladder modulator of shortwave transmitter, in which both the arithmetic designand the simulation results are included.Nowadays, mass radios in domestic adopt control system of PSM (PulseStep Modulation) modulator. However, they are realized in simulation almost.Many processes are realized in hardware circuit. The fimction of system isrestricted due to guideline of parts of an apparatus is simulative. On the otherhand, control system of modulator is not able to detect when it run. Thus, whenfault appeared, high-voltage lose control of modulator and long-playingshutdown are inevitably. Digital rebuilding in originally system is urgentlyneeded for finding a control system that it has more steady, reliable andextensible. This paper discussed control system of PSM modulator whichadopted 32 bit float DSP and 24 bit A/D. The system has extraordinary processprecision. Soft arithmetic replaced hardware realizing make system moreminiature and flexible, moreover, upgrade become easier.This paper presents two new methods that they are improving equivalentarea and extending symmetry synchronization sampling. The method ofimproving equivalent area modified the station of PWM making them changealong with error of PSM. Thus it can restrain hypo-frequency better and make ,error of phase depress. The method of extending symmetry synchronizationsampling has more high-speed. It changed amount of PWM via altering samplefrequency which is changed getting across linearity interpolation. This methodmakes the compensation more consummate and the wave of output perfect.Moreover, these are fit for realized by DSP. This paper made out analysis incomputer simulation to the new methods and approved their excellent capability.In addition, this paper put forward the design precept of measuringfrequency circuit and switch module circle on-off. Then this digital controlsystem is more consummate and can monitor status of running and eliminatemalfunction automatically making broadcast continuously is possible.
